[PATCH net-next] bridge: mcast: Default back to multicast enabled state

Commit 13cefad2f2c1 ("net: bridge: convert and rename mcast disabled")
converted the 'multicast_disabled' field to an option bit named
'BROPT_MULTICAST_ENABLED'.

While the old field was implicitly initialized to 0, the new field is
not initialized, resulting in the bridge defaulting to multicast
disabled state and breaking existing applications.

Fix this by explicitly initializing the option.

Fixes: 13cefad2f2c1 ("net: bridge: convert and rename mcast disabled")
Signed-off-by: Ido Schimmel <redacted>
---
 net/bridge/br_multicast.c | 1 +
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)
diff --git a/net/bridge/br_multicast.c b/net/bridge/br_multicast.c
index 928024d8360d..024139b51d3a 100644
--- a/net/bridge/br_multicast.c
+++ b/net/bridge/br_multicast.c
@@ -1976,6 +1976,7 @@ void br_multicast_init(struct net_bridge *br)
 	br->ip6_other_query.delay_time = 0;
 	br->ip6_querier.port = NULL;
 #endif
+	br_opt_toggle(br, BROPT_MULTICAST_ENABLED, true);
 	br_opt_toggle(br, BROPT_HAS_IPV6_ADDR, true);
 
 	spin_lock_init(&br->multicast_lock);
